Full-stack Engineer - Node.js, React Native - Consumer facing market

4+ years
Long-term (40h)
Consumer facing
Full Remote
TypeScript
Node.js
PostgreSQL
React.js
React Native

Requirements

Must-haves

  • 4+ years of full-stack development experience
  • Proficiency with React Native
  • Proficiency with TypeScript
  • Proficiency with React
  • Proficiency with Node.js
  • Proficiency with Express
  • Experience with relational databases, preferably PostgreSQL
  • Previous experience delivering production-level applications using similar stacks
  • Communication skills in both spoken and written English

Nice-to-haves

  • Startup experience
  • Experience with Redux, Tailwind CSS
  • Experience with mobile app development using iOS, Android and/or React Native
  • Proficiency with Next.js or other server-side JS frameworks
  • Experience building scalable back-end systems for high-growth products
  • Bachelor's Degree in Computer Engineering, Computer Science, or equivalent

What you will work on

  • Build and maintain a social shopping recommendation tool
  • Develop and support both front-end and back-end of the application
  • Create and manage full-stack applications in a production environment
  • Work with TypeScript, React (front end), Node.js, Express (back end)
  • Design and maintain relational databases with a focus on PostgreSQL
  • Collaborate with the team to deliver high-quality production code